Abstract
As a new perspective for understanding firm responsiveness to stakeholder concerns, we propose a strategic cognition view of issue salience—that is, the degree to which a stakeholder issue resonates with and is prioritized by management. Specifically, we explain how a firm's cognitive structures of organizational identity and strategic frames use different core logics to influence managerial interpretation of an issue as salient.
